Answer:

[tex](1-sinA-cosA)^2 = 2(1-sinA)(1-cosA)\\Solution,\\L.H.S. = (1-sinA-cosA)^2 = [(1-sinA)-cosA]^2\\~~~~~~~~~~=(1-sinA)^2-2cosA(1-sinA)+cos^2A\\~~~~~~~~~~=1-2sinA+sin^2A-2cosA(1-sinA)+cos^2A\\~~~~~~~~~~=1-2sinA+sin^2A+cos^2A-2cosA(1-sinA)\\~~~~~~~~~~=1-2sinA+1-2cosA(1-sinA)\\~~~~~~~~~~=2-2sinA-2cosA(1-sinA)\\~~~~~~~~~~=2(1-sinA)-2cosA(1-sinA)\\~~~~~~~~~~=(1-sinA)(2-2cosA)= 2(1-sinA)(1-cosA)[/tex]
